Kōhhā-ye Awrīj
Kōhhā-ye Awrīj is a mountain in Naw Zad District, Helmand Province and has an elevation of 1,968 metres. Kōhhā-ye Awrīj is situated nearby to the locality Gham Bāḏ, as well as near Kajakī.| Tap on a place to explore it |
